Indefinite demonstrative pronouns (ce, ceci, cela, ça) do not agree with the nouns they replace in gender or number. - Lawless French
Demonstrative pronouns (celui, celle, ceux, celles) replace a specific noun that was mentioned previously and must agree with it in number and gender.
ça and cela are the same thing but "ça" is way more common colloquially (cela can be quite formal)
